Found on the army base at the southern pointer of Sundown Cliffs Natural Park, the Old Factor Loma Lighthouse (constructed in 1855) offered as a sign for seafarers for centuries, and today acts as a link to our past. The Old Factor Loma Lighthouse stood supervise the entrance to San Diego Bay for 36 years.


What seemed to be an excellent location 422 feet over sea level, nevertheless, had a severe flaw. Fog and low clouds commonly obscured the light. On March 23, 1891, the light was snuffed out and the keeper relocated to a new lighthouse place closer to the water at the pointer of the Factor.

The Venetian Court homes are still standing almost 100 years after they were constructed, a long time icon of the picturesque California coast. After strong storms damaged the area for the second wintertime in a row, they're likewise emblematic of the difficulties areas along the coast will certainly battle in the face of environment modification.


Rispin had also larger dreams of transforming Capitola right into a second Venice, and acquired much more land beyond the oceanfront to help realize it (California attraction)."Henry Allen Rispin descended upon Capitola like a summer season storm . Directly peaceful and timid; his concepts and plans were a striking comparison, and once devoted there was no turn back


Rispin began partitioning and offering his land, consisting of demolishing the town's little Italian angling town near the water, where the colorful Venetian Court homes stand today. A San Jose realty programmer eventually purchased the seaside parcel from Rispin and created the five-structure, 24-unit condominium growth that's still standing. The homes sold by the end of 1926, which very same year, among the brand-new owners chose to open a motel, a brand-new preferred lodging for travelers, just behind the court.
